Podcast : Gordon Wells – Scottish Island Voices

In the latest of our podcast series Gordon Wells talks about the Scottish Island Voices project. This project was undertaken by Sabhal Mór Ostaig (SMO), which is Scotland’s Gaeilic College, and Cothrom Training Ltd. In partnership they worked on developing language teaching materials and the project ran as part of the larger Leonardo project called POOLS (Producing Open Online Learning Systems), which had 9 partners around Europe.

The Scottish Island Voices was awarded a 2007 European Award for Languages, and was a bilingual project and aimed to encourage the use of new technology in learning and teaching.

Gordon talks about the project, his role in the project, and the benefits to those involved in the project and he encourages anyone interested in following a similar model to develop such materials to make contact with him.
